What is the sales tax on a car in Louisville, Kentucky?

Kentucky charges 6% state sales tax on vehicle purchases. Louisville may add local taxes on top of the state rate. The out-the-door price — including all taxes, fees, and registration — is the only number that matters when comparing deals.
